Sat 700222529325082

decimal
140044.2529325082
degree
0°140044′940″2529325082‴
percentile
33.34393000453939%
name
iwuaefnxvlf
cycle
0
epoch
0
period
69
block
140044
offset
2529325082
timestamp
rarity
common